Subject: Customer Support Outsourcing — Briefing for Branch Managers

Team,

We intend to transition tier-one support to Hollyfern Services starting in October. Branch queues will route through their Marwick facility during a three-month overlap. Headcount impacts are limited to two roles, both offered redeployment. Training materials go out next week. The confidential details of the transition plan follow below.

board note of kafog-bajep: Briathek Partners is in early talks to buy Aldaelek Group for about $47.1 million. The Ulaath launch date is September 4, and nothing goes to the press before then.

### Step 3: Migrate the Tallygrove metrics sidecar

If you're new to the team, read this whole step before running anything. The Tallygrove metrics-aggregation sidecar previously scraped endpoints on a fixed interval defined in code; version 4 moves all scrape, flush, and downsampling behaviour into an external file loaded at startup. If that file is missing, the sidecar will start but silently aggregate nothing, which has bitten us twice. Create the file in the sidecar's mount directory and populate it with the values that follow.

config for haweg-bagag:
[kasath]
host = kasath.qirvancorp.internal
user = kasath_svc
database = kasath_prod

Build provenance — GlacierTile cache layer. Every GlacierTile release is produced by the sealed pipeline at Norholm, with no manual artifact uploads permitted. The pipeline records the source revision, toolchain digest, and dependency lockfile hash into a signed attestation stored alongside the artifact. Reviewers should confirm the attestation signature chains to the Norholm release key and that the lockfile hash matches the audited manifest. The canonical reference for cross-checking this release is the provenance token below.

build token for kagaf-hahof: htk14_9d3d4d26d7d8de

TilePuller prefetcher — onboarding notes

TilePuller warms the map-tile cache ahead of predicted demand in the Norwick region feeds. It runs hourly; skipped runs self-heal on the next cycle. Never raise the fetch concurrency above 8 without checking upstream quota. Config reference, failure modes, and tuning history are all kept on the internal page below.

dashboard of kahof-kajef = https://confluence.braskdata.corp/spaces